Try, opening OE6 go to tools, options, mail format, then click fonts. I am
not sure, but think this is where you find the change, if your looking to
chance your font in OE6 for email.
 
If you want to change the Fonts for Internet Explorer go to tools,
Internet Options, Fonts.
